英文詞源
- ergo (conj.)
- c. 1400, from Latin ergo "therefore, in consequence of," possibly from *ex rogo "from the direction," from ex "out of" (see ex-) + root of regere "to guide" (see regal). Used in logic to introduce the conclusion of a complete and necessary syllogism.
